The stars came out to support Lollipops and Rainbows Foundation’s celebrity launch on Saturday May 2nd at Universal Citywalk in Los Angeles.
"Dancing with the Stars" pro dancer Lacey Schwimmer, who partnered with Steve-O this season, was one of several notables who came out to show their support.
Even teen singer and actress Miley Cyrus came out to support the charity, founded by eight-year old Emily Grace Reaves ( "Cindy Lou" in the Hannah Montana Movie). The foundation is a tribute to Emily's grandfather Dave Reaves who came up with the idea 10 years ago.
According to her publicist "there is no bigger supporter" to Emily than her older brother and bestfriend Josh, who selected St. Jude's Children's Hospital as one of the foundation's charity recipients.
Braison Cyrus also performed with his band Lazy Randy at the celebration.
